We had a new patio done a few years ago. We never had a seal put on it. With sun exposure and power washing the color of the concrete began to fade. We initially planned to have Santana Concrete do a seal only, but after it was power washed and ready we decided to stain it also. The "stock" colors did not produce the color I wanted so Misael agreed to mix some. He was patient through the process, and I could tell he wanted me to be happy with the result. We had some old grey steps next to our new pour, but with the new stain you can't tell! The color combo worked beautifully and we are thrilled with the result. Thank you Santana Concrete!
